If you enjoy a beverage ever so often, keep your cash at home if you set out to do your consuming in a casino. I am serious. Leave your evening bag, your billfold, and keep all cash, charge cards and chequebooks at home. Only take only the money you anticipate to use on drinks, tips and few dollars you expect to throw away and keep the remainder behind.

Contemptuous? Absolutely not. Just realistic. You could experience a profit after a intoxicated evening out with your buddies and be blessed sufficiently to hook a 25 minute toss at a hot craps table. Don’t forget that story considering that it’s as short-lived as it gets if you continuously consume alcohol and gamble. These activities just don’t go well together.

Keeping your moola at home might be a tiny bit excessive, but precautionary actions for dramatic behavior is essential. If you wager to succeed, then don’t drink and play. If you like to be wasteful with your assets without a concern, then consume all the complimentary booze your stomach are able to handle, but don’t carry plastic credit and cheques to toss into the mix of going after losses after your inebriated self loses everything!

Let me to take this a single step further. Don’t consume alcohol and then jump online to gamble in your favorite online casino either. I enjoy a drink from the comfort of my condo, but since I’m connected through Neteller, Firepay and have charge cards at my fingertips, I can’t drink and gamble.

What’s the reason? Despite the fact that I don’t consume alcohol to excess, when I drink, it’s clearly enough to cloud my better judgment. I gamble, so I do not consume alcohol when wagering. If you are a drinker, do not wager at the same time. When mixed, both create a decimating, and expensive, drink.
